Don't include libwireshark headers from libwiretap.
Move the definitions of hashipv4_t and hashipv6_t to wiretap/wtap.h, as
that's the main place they're used. Change them a bit not to depend on
other stuff from libwireshark, and change the code as required by those
changes.
This should fix the Solaris build; apparently, the Sun^WOracle compiler
is generating code for static inline functions even if they're never
called, so that libwiretap ends up including code that calls tvbuff and
wmem functions.
There's probably further cleanup that could be done here, but this
should at least fix the build, as well as getting rid of a dependency
between two libraries that are at least somewhat independent (libwiretap
should *not* depend on libwireshark, as some programs use libwiretap but
not libwireshark, and, ultimately, we probably want it to be possible to
use libwireshark without libwiretap but that'd be more work).

Have "get_host_ipaddr()" return a Boolean indicating whether it
succeeded or failed, and, if it succeeded, have it fill in the IP
address if found through a pointer passed as the second argument.
Have it first try interpreting its first argument as a dotted-quad IP
address, with "inet_aton()", and, if that fails, have it try to
interpret it as a host name with "gethostbyname()"; don't bother with
"gethostbyaddr()", as we should be allowed to filter on IP addresses
even if there's no host name associated with them (there's no guarantee
that "gethostbyaddr()" will succeed if handed an IP address with no
corresponding name - and it looks as if FreeBSD 3.2, at least, may not
succeed in that case).
Add a "dfilter_fail()" routine that takes "printf()"-like arguments and
uses them to set an error message for the parse; doing so means that
even if the filter expression is syntactically valid, we treat it as
being invalid. (Is there a better way to force a parse to fail from
arbitrary places in routines called by the parser?)
Use that routine in the lexical analyzer.
If that error message was set, use it as is as the failure message,
rather than adding "Unable to parse filter string XXX" to it.
Have the code to handle IP addresses and host names in display filters
check whether "get_host_ipaddr()" succeeded or failed and, if it failed,
arrange that the parse fail with an error message indicating the source
of the problem.
